2548827329 发表于 2013-4-21 19:54:43

王爽的汇编实验五(5)

本帖最后由 2548827329 于 2013-4-22 22:43 编辑


用masm6.15编译错误如下:

Assembling: 5.asm
error A4910: cannot open file: E:\try\ML.err
5.asm(10) : error A2008:: c
5.asm(11) : error A2034:
5.asm(12) : error A2008:: c
5.asm(16) : error A2008:: cassume cs:code
a segment
db 1,2,3,4,5,6,7,8
a ends

b segment
db 1,2,3,4,5,6,7,8
b ends

csegment
db 0,0,0,0,0,0,0,0
cends

code segment
start:mov bx,0
   mov ax,c
       mov ss,ax
   mov ax,a
       mov ds,ax
       mov ax,b
       mov es,ax
       mov cx,8
s:       mov al,
   mov ss:,al
       mov dl,es:
       add ss:,dl
       inc bx
       
       loop s


   mov ax,4c00h
       int 21h

code ends
end start

2548827329 发表于 2013-4-21 20:10:45

本帖最后由 2548827329 于 2013-4-21 20:16 编辑

掉了一行mov cx,8可是把这行加上去错误还是一样的

、_归属 发表于 2013-4-22 19:27:24

,我也是这个错误,实在想不通,只好放在那里,等复习的时候,再去想,哈哈

2548827329 发表于 2013-4-22 22:31:12

、_归属 发表于 2013-4-22 19:27 static/image/common/back.gif
,我也是这个错误,实在想不通,只好放在那里,等复习的时候,再去想,哈哈

我的代码有错误,看别人写的就能编译http://bbs.fishc.com/forum.php?mod=viewthread&tid=29601&extra=page%3D1%26filter%3Dtypeid%26typeid%3D2%26typeid%3D2
要把c改成cc就可以了,不知道为什么
页: [1]
查看完整版本: 王爽的汇编实验五(5)